Two Albanians aged 23 and 24 have been in police custody since Sunday evening, April 28, at the Bordeaux police station for attempted murder. The first is suspected of having stabbed a 19-year-old young man several times with the complicity of his cousin. The attack took place on rue Durcy in Bègles.

It was around 4:15 p.m. this Sunday April 28 when the two Albanians insulted a group of young people in the street at the foot of an HLM building. The tone rises and the two men come down for a face-to-face which quickly turns into a fight. Punches are exchanged, but very quickly one of the Albanians takes out a knife and strikes five or six blows in the back of the victim who is very seriously injured. The emergency services were alerted and evacuated the latter to the University Hospital in a condition considered very worrying. His vital prognosis was in jeopardy.

Meanwhile, the alleged perpetrator of the attack and his cousin disappear. They will be located and arrested very quickly by the police as they were preparing to take the train at Saint-Jean station, presumably to reach Belgium where their family resides. The investigation was entrusted to the Territorial Crime Division (DCT). Investigations are ongoing.
